Disconnecting Battery Cables
The use of rubber gloves is recommended when working with batteries.
NEVER allow any of your tools and/or battery cables to contact both battery
terminals at the same time. An electrical short may occur and serious personal
injury or damage may occur.
NOTE: For this procedure, refer to FIGURE 12.6 on page 67.
1. Remove the batteries. Refer to Removing/Installing the Batteries on page 57.
2. Cut the tie‐wrap that secures the battery terminal cap in place (Detail "B" of
FIGURE 12.6).
3. Slide terminal caps up onto the battery cables (FIGURE 12.6).
4. Disconnect POSITIVE (+) battery cable from the POSITIVE (+) battery terminal
(FIGURE 12.6).
5. Disconnect NEGATIVE (‐) battery cable from NEGATIVE (‐) battery terminal
(FIGURE 12.6).
